vmnet macOS 11.3 to 12.0 API Differences

vmnet.h
Added vmnet_enable_checksum_offload_key
Added vmnet_interface_add_ip_port_forwarding_rule()
Added vmnet_interface_remove_ip_port_forwarding_rule()
Added vmnet_interface_get_ip_port_forwarding_rules_handler_t
Added vmnet_ip_port_forwarding_rule_get_details()
Added vmnet_interface_get_ip_port_forwarding_rules()
Modified vmnet_interface_add_port_forwarding_rule()
AvailabilityDeprecation Message
FromAvailablenone
ToDeprecatedreplaced by vmnet_interface_add_ip_port_forwarding_rule

Modified vmnet_interface_remove_port_forwarding_rule()
AvailabilityDeprecation Message
FromAvailablenone
ToDeprecatedreplaced by vmnet_interface_remove_ip_port_forwarding_rule

Modified vmnet_port_forwarding_rule_get_details()
AvailabilityDeprecation Message
FromAvailablenone
ToDeprecatedreplaced by vmnet_ip_port_forwarding_rule_get_details

Modified vmnet_interface_get_port_forwarding_rules()
AvailabilityDeprecation Message
FromAvailablenone
ToDeprecatedreplaced by vmnet_interface_get_ip_port_forwarding_rules